City of Hope’s growing national system includes its Los Angeles campus, a network of clinical care locations across Southern California, a new cancer center in Orange County, California, and treatment facilities in Atlanta, Chicago and Phoenix. The Operations Program Manager will support the development and implementation of strategic initiatives in support of City of Hope’s enterprise support operations. This includes working with on-site vendors at different outpatient locations.

As a successful candidate, you will:

  • Develop and monitor key performance metrics
  • Coordinate and manage operational activities to improve support services integration, efficiency and analytics associated with City of Hope’s support programs and facilities
  • Routinely report on performance to Enterprise Support Operations
  • Develop and maintain the budget, timeline, and implementation plan
  • Directly lead the management of strategic initiatives and support services integration initiatives from inception to implementation
  • Create and execute project plans, timelines, and budgets

Your qualifications should include: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Health Administration, Public Health, or Business Administration. Experience may substitute for minimum education requirements
  • Two years of experience working in property management, healthcare, or hospital operations.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Ability to work independently.
  • Excellent people skills required.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Hospital and/or ambulatory operations experience
  • Project management experience
  • Master’s degree
